Abravanel Corridor’s plaza is now an outside live performance corridor — for this summer season at the least


SALT LAKE CITY — A number of pedestrians had been sucked into the Abravanel Corridor plaza Friday afternoon as Misha Galant hammered away on a grand piano positioned outdoors of the long-lasting downtown live performance corridor.

Galant is an expert pianist and carried out as a part of a mini-concert celebrating the launch of an bold artwork venture known as “Key Adjustments.” Nevertheless, a key element of the venture is you do not have to be an knowledgeable to play outdoors the venue.

The Gina Bachauer Worldwide Piano Basis — together with Salt Lake Metropolis and Salt Lake County arts representatives — unveiled six uniquely upcycled pianos on Friday that can stay outdoors of Abravanel Corridor by September. Anybody can come and play, however there can even be outside concert events held within the plaza on June 28, July 26, Aug. 23 and Sept. 26.

“I can not wait to see how our downtown guests come and make the most of these lovely artistic endeavors all through the summer season,” mentioned Matt Castillo, director of the Salt Lake County Arts and Tradition.

The thought began with the Gina Bachauer Worldwide Piano Basis. Kary Billings, the nonprofit’s govt director, mentioned the group was impressed by varied different cities which have explored comparable ideas to inspire folks to care about music. It additionally goals to assist promote the upcoming Gina Bachauer Worldwide Artists Piano Competitors, slated to be held in Salt Lake Metropolis from June 16 by June 29.

The nonprofit submitted an utility by a program overseen by the Blocks, a company that promotes arts and leisure in Salt Lake Metropolis and Salt Lake County, to assist fund the venture. Britney Helmers, the group’s program director, was immediately bought on the concept.

“We thought it was completely wonderful,” she mentioned. “(It is) highlighting visible arts and performing arts in a single program. What else may we ask for?”

All six pianos had been donated to the muse, both from donors or different foundations. As soon as the Blocks — and different associate organizations — received concerned, the muse’s leaders reached out to native artists to design them. Ryan Harrington, Chuck Landvatter, Evan Jed Memmott, Richard Taylor, Kalani Tonga Tufuaku and Ben Wiemeyer had been ultimately chosen and given lower than a month to design the pianos by Friday’s unveiling.

The six artists used totally different influences of their designs.

Bachauer Piano posted brief tales behind all six designs on social media earlier than the disclosing occasion. For instance, Tufuaku defined her paintings usually blends Pacific Island patterns blended with a “nontraditional colour palette.” On this case, she additionally determined to merge the totally different nationwide flowers of the pianists competing within the upcoming worldwide competitors into her design.

“This was one of the vital thrilling issues I’ve labored on in a number of years,” she mentioned on Friday, moments earlier than her youngsters, Kalea and Kamila, peeled off a tarp to disclose her remaining product.

Billings mentioned the artists had been additionally warned the pianos would stay outdoors for a whole summer season, so all of them labored as finest as they might to include methods to guard the devices from the climate and “no matter else that may occur downtown.”

In fact, Abravanel Corridor has gotten loads of consideration since Key Adjustments was organized. Greater than 40,000 folks have signed a web based petition since Might 4 in search of to protect the 45-year-old live performance corridor after it turned evident that the venue may very well be impacted by a proposed leisure district outdoors of the Delta Heart.

Salt Lake County Mayor Jenny Wilson mentioned she was “working diligently” to maintain Abravanel Corridor “in its current kind” transferring ahead since then. The county, which oversees the constructing, printed a report estimating renovations would price about $200 million. Smith Leisure Group executives mentioned they’ll “help” the county’s resolution on the way forward for Abravanel Corridor and the Utah Museum of Modern Arts.

Key Adjustments may present much more curiosity in Abravanel Corridor as negotiations over the district proceed. Castillo mentioned he isn’t conscious if the venue has held a program prefer it earlier than and it is unclear if this might be a one-time factor or a brand new custom; nevertheless, he factors out that it matches into the county’s purpose of using the live performance corridor’s plaza.

“We have at all times been in search of alternatives to activate the plaza extra, so that is actually simply the proper alternative for that,” he mentioned, as somebody performed the “Tremendous Mario Bros” theme behind him.

“That is actually an ideal mix of music, creation, artwork and all these issues — and an ideal alternative to activate the plaza extra.”
